Magnificent stained glass depicting stories from the Bible

The stained glass of Milan Cathedral was mainly created from the 15th to 16th centuries, and depicts stories from the Bible with delicate use of color. In particular, the huge stained glass in the apse (behind the altar) is a masterpiece. The glass, which is over 20 meters high, depicts episodes from the Old and New Testaments in detail, speaking to you like a painting.

Craftsmanship with attention to detail

The stained glass of Milan Cathedral is not just a decoration, but also the crystallization of the craftsmen's outstanding skills. By painting each piece of glass with a different color and connecting them with lead, a delicate expression like a painting is achieved. Its beauty that remains today is the result of the efforts of the craftsmen who have restored and preserved it over many years.
